LAUTEC wins Formosa 4 QHSE contract
LAUTEC has been awarded a framework consultancy agreement to provide site QA/QC and HSE services for Synera Renewable Energy's 495MW Formosa 4 offshore wind farm in Taiwan. The contract covers quality and HSE personnel overseeing fabrication, manufacturing, assembly, and installation activities across major project packages, including foundations, cables, onshore and offshore substations, and wind turbine generators. This agreement supports the development of a significant offshore wind project expected to supply electricity for approximately 500,000 Taiwanese households.
